Isotoma axillaris is a species in the Isotoma genus, commonly called laurentia, a wildflower, and with a herbaceous growth habit. Its native range is Coastal regions of Australia. Reference care guidance for Isotoma axillaris suggests full sun light, medium watering, warm temperatures, and moderate humidity; collector consensus will refine this as more public specimens are added.
